Active OOSH (AO) provides a home away from home for children in its care (Before School Care, After School Care and during School Holidays). We are passionate about providing high-quality care and education to primary school-aged children in a fun, safe, active environment so that every child looks forward to AO, and feels welcome and supported. The Area Manager plays a pivotal role in leading and supporting a group of Coordinators across multiple services in the Manning/Great Lakes region to ensure that services operate to the highest standards of compliance, quality and performance. The Area Manager is responsible for mentoring staff, resolving complex issues, supporting recruitment and onboarding, and driving the success of each service through proactive leadership, handson involvement and strategic oversight. Key Responsibilities Provide service oversight and support have an onsite presence to suit operational needs, manage staff leave, assist Coordinators in managing service aesthetics, and lead weekly service staff meetings. Provide leadership and people management mentor and coach Coordinators, complete performance reviews, identify staff progression, liaise with Head Office around recruitment needs, oversee the onboarding of new team members and manage conflict resolution. Compliance and quality assurance ensure full compliance at services, provide support around Inclusion Support applications, and provide guidance around enrolments for children with additional needs. Operational and administrative support support Coordinators to complete administrative tasks, identify opportunities to boost enrolments, be the "link" between Head Office and regional services, monitor and track performance against key operational metrics. Key Skills and Attributes Experience within the childcare, daycare or education sector. Leadership skills and the ability to manage a small team effectively. A friendly, position and solutionsfocused approach. Good organisational skills to juggle competing priorities. A strong understanding of the National Quality Framework (My Time, Our Place), and other relevant legislation and regulations would be highly regarded. Qualifications/Certifications A current paid Working With Children Check is required. Current qualifications in Child Care First Aid (HLTAID012), CPR (HLTAID009) and Child Protection (CHCPRT025), or be willing to obtain. Safe Food Handling Certificate, or be willing to obtain.
